Abstract(in English) We investigate the splice losses characteristics observed in hole-assisted fiber (HAF) intrinsically. We experimentally examine the mode-coupling loss induced by the matching materials penetrating air holes at mechanical splice. We show that satisfactory good splice loss can be obtained by considering refractive index and temperature coefficient of the matching material. We also numerically examine MFD mismatch loss which is induced when air holes are vanished with fusion splice. We show that MFD mismatch loss can be reduced by controlling hole distance taking into account the normalized frequency of core.
